Economic Impact of Online Gaming
The financial side of online gaming is another area of significant growth. In fact, the global video game industry, including online gaming, is expected to generate billions of dollars annually. This vast economic ecosystem includes game development, streaming services, esports tournaments, and even in-game purchases.
Esports, competitive video gaming, has emerged as a billion-dollar industry in its own right. Esports events are held worldwide, attracting millions of viewers both in-person and online. Professional gamers can now earn lucrative salaries, sponsorships, and endorsement deals, creating career opportunities that were unimaginable just a few years ago.
In-game purchases, such as skins, avatars, and loot boxes, have become a profitable model for many developers. This “microtransaction” system allows gamers to personalize their experience and gives developers a steady stream of revenue, contributing to the industry’s continued growth.
The Impact on Mental Health
While online gaming offers numerous benefits, it is not without its challenges. Excessive gaming can lead to negative mental health outcomes, such as addiction, social isolation, and physical health issues like eye strain or poor posture. Striking a balance between gaming and other activities is essential for maintaining a healthy lifestyle.
However, it’s important to note that gaming itself doesn’t inherently cause these problems. Responsible gaming practices, including time limits, regular breaks, and maintaining other aspects of life such as physical exercise and social interactions, can help mitigate potential risks. Many gaming platforms and developers are taking steps to address these issues by implementing features such as time-tracking tools and promoting healthy gaming habits.
The Future of Online Gaming
The future of online gaming looks brighter than ever. With advancements in artificial intelligence (AI), VR, and 5G technology, the online gaming experience will only become more immersive and engaging. AI is already being used to enhance gameplay, providing more realistic NPCs (non-player characters) and dynamic environments. VR and AR are set to revolutionize how players interact with games, allowing for truly immersive experiences where the line between the virtual and the real world becomes blurred.
Moreover, the growth of cloud gaming platforms, such as Google Stadia and Xbox Cloud Gaming, is making it easier than ever for players to access high-quality games without needing expensive hardware. This could democratize access to gaming and bring the joy of online gaming to a wider audience.
